The Plant Biology Institute, headed by Professor Steve Kelly, is a key part of the EIT Oxford. The institute aims to develop impactful and commercially sustainable solutions for improving global food production and planetary health through pioneering plant science research.
The Plant Biology Institute will unite world-class researchers focused on expanding the frontiers of plant science. Our research is focused on enhancing our ability to feed the planet while simultaneously improving the climate and ecosystem outcomes of food production. By embedding cutting-edge plant science research within an organisation that is focused on solving global challenges at scale, we aim to accelerate the timeline from discovery to global impact.
Areas of Exploration
- Improved plant productivity, both indoors and outside
- Reduced reliance on inputs including water, fertilisers, pesticides, and herbicides
- Novel decarbonised plant-based production platforms for food and medicines
- Advanced technologies that speed up discovery and deployment in plants
Researchers will have access to state-of-the-art laboratory and plant growth facilities and have opportunities to collaborate with experts at the forefront of research on AI, automation, and generative biology across the EIT ecosystem. They will also work with global leaders in market development, commercialisation, and impact creation. The Plant Biology Institute has long-term substantial funding to support the unique scale and ambition of its vision.
Your Role
We are seeking a visionary and accomplished Group Leader/Senior Group Leader in Plant Phenotyping to lead a transformative research programme at the forefront of plant biotechnology. This senior leadership role is central to shaping a newly established and rapidly scaling Plant Biology Institute with the ambition to become a global leader in plant phenotyping and data-driven plant science.
The successful candidate will lead an innovative research programme focused on the development and application of next-generation plant phenotyping technologies, including automated, high-throughput, and sensor-based approaches that enable precise, scalable measurement of plant performance across indoor and outdoor environments.
The successful candidate will establish and lead PBI's automated phenotyping function, delivering analytical capabilities and workflows to support PBI's trait and technology research groups. This role requires close collaboration with research scientists working across a broad range of projects including plant and plant cell culture engineering. The role will require working with other institutional stakeholders to scope, design, equip, and operate a new function within the research institute. The role will drive research from foundational method development through to integrated platforms for real-world application, supporting advances in crop improvement, resilience, and productivity.
The postholder will build and lead a high-performing, interdisciplinary team spanning biology, engineering, data science, and automation; establish strategic collaborations across academia, industry, and technology partners; and ensure research excellence is translated into impactful and commercially relevant solutions aligned with EIT's mission of humane and sustainable innovation. This is a rare opportunity to define the scientific and technological direction of a next-generation phenotyping programme addressing some of the most pressing challenges in global agriculture and sustainability.
